NetBank, Inc. Securities Litigation Certified as Class Action by Court
PHILADELPHIA, Oct. 28 /PRNewswire/ -- Berger & Montague, P.C., Lead Counsel for Lead Plaintiff and the Class in the NetBank, Inc. Securities Litigation class action suit, announced the following:

TO: ALL PERSONS WHO, DURING THE PERIOD MARCH 16, 2005 THROUGH AND INCLUDING MAY 21, 2007, PURCHASED OR OTHERWISE ACQUIRED THE PUBLICLY-REGISTERED COMMON STOCK OF NETBANK, INC. ("NETBANK"), AND HELD SUCH STOCK AS OF MAY 21, 2007, AND WERE DAMAGED AS A RESULT ("THE CLASS").
YOU ARE HEREBY NOTIFIED that a class action has been certified in the above entitled matter pending before the Honorable Timothy C. Batten, Sr., United States District Judge for the Northern District of Georgia. The action asserts claims against Defendants Douglas K. Freeman, James P. Gross, Steven F. Herbert, Thomas H. Muller, Jr., Eula L. Adams and David W. Johnson, Jr., for alleged violations of the federal securities laws.
